Dear doctor, I am 39years old. Height is 166CMs., with a weight of 70Kgs. Recently I could find Albumin + in the urine test done . The Microscopic Examination RBCs 1-2 Pus cells 12-15 Epithelial Cells Many kideny function test in blood serum creatinine H1.3 blood urea H47 serum uric acid 5.60 i have now one kideny and I m doing myself a catheter to empty the bladder because when i am small I had a narrowing of the urethra. so doctor tell me do that . so i want to knew is there any problem that epithelial cells many
Your findings may suggest urinary tract infection(UTI) with mildly raised renal function tests. UTI is indicated by excess pus cells and RBC in urine. Epithelial cells are normally found in urine. RBC and albumin + may be related to UTI.
You need proper clinical examination and routine investigations. Investigations include routine hemogram,random blood sugar,ultrasound of abdomen,urine culture/sensitivity.
Proper antibiotics should be based upon culture and sensitivity report. Nitrite test and leukocyte esterase test can be done for confirmation of urinary tract infection. Drink plenty of water. I also suggests alkalyzing syrups to my patients.
You may need follow up renal function test and diet restrictions due to mildly raised renal function test.
